Kinds of Air Conditioning Systems for Any Home
When choosing an air conditioning system, homeowners are presented with a variety of options suited to different needs and lifestyles. Central AC systems are well known for their effectiveness in cooling entire homes, often utilizing ductwork for air distribution. Ductless mini-split systems deliver flexibility, allowing homeowners to control temperatures in individual rooms without the necessity of extensive duct systems. Window units act as an affordable solution for cooling smaller spaces, as portable air conditioners deliver convenience and simple installation. Moreover, geothermal systems leverage the ground's stable temperature to offer efficient heating and cooling solutions. Each option presents distinct advantages, such as varying degrees of energy efficiency, installation expenses, and cooling potential. Insufficient Cooling Problems
Poor cooling performance can make homeowners feel uncomfortable and irritated, especially during the sweltering summer months. Frequent reasons for inadequate cooling typically involve dirty air filters, which limit air circulation, and blocked vents that stop cooled air from moving throughout the space. Refrigerant leaks can also hinder performance, as depleted refrigerant levels impair the system's capacity to properly cool air. Moreover, units that are not properly sized may fail to sustain comfortable temperatures, leading to irregular cooling in different areas of the home. Thermostat issues, such as incorrect settings or malfunctioning devices, can further exacerbate the problem. Regular maintenance, including filter changes and system checks, can help identify these issues early, guaranteeing the cooling system runs effectively and maintains household comfort throughout every season.
Strange Sounds Diagnosis
Detecting strange audio signals from an air conditioning unit is important for determining potential problems. Standard audio warning signs feature rattling, which may signal loose components, and hissing, typically a symptom of refrigerant leaks. A scraping noise can indicate issues with the motor or bearings, while a high-pitched squeal might signal a problem with the fan or compressor. In addition, a bubbling sound could suggest refrigerant issues. Every sound acts as a clue to underlying mechanical failures, prompting timely inspections and repairs. Property owners ought not to dismiss these auditory warnings; moving decisively can prevent further damage and costly repairs. Consistent maintenance may also prevent these issues, making certain the equipment functions smoothly and quietly.

Smart Thermostat Setup
Setting up a smart thermostat can considerably boost an air conditioning system's energy performance. These systems allow homeowners to schedule temperature settings based on their daily routines, ensuring that the AC operates only when required. By learning user preferences over time, smart thermostats make automatic adjustments, lowering energy consumption during peak hours. Several models include remote access through smartphones, empowering users to track and adjust their home's climate from any location. This level of convenience not only enhances comfort but also produces significant cost savings on energy bills. Additionally, some smart thermostats generate usage reports, helping homeowners identify patterns and make informed adjustments. Overall, incorporating a smart thermostat can be a straightforward yet impactful step toward optimizing air conditioning performance.
Seasonal Preparations for Your Air Conditioning System
Readying an air conditioning system for the next season is essential for maintaining optimal performance and energy savings. Households should kick off by looking over the outdoor unit for debris, such as leaves or dirt, which can impede proper ventilation. Replacing or cleaning the air filters is also an essential step, as clogged filters can reduce efficiency and air quality. In addition, checking the refrigerant levels can prevent potential cooling problems; low levels may indicate a leak that requires professional attention.
It is also wise to check the thermostat settings to verify proper temperature management. Scheduling a professional maintenance check can greatly boost system performance, permitting technicians to uncover underlying concerns. Additionally, homeowners ought to consider filling any gaps around windows and doors to reduce energy loss. By taking these proactive measures, homeowners can ensure their air conditioning systems function efficiently during the entire season, delivering comfort within the home.

How Regularly Should I Change My Air Conditioning Filter?
Air conditioner filters should typically be replaced every one to three months, based on usage frequency and filter type. Regular replacements enhance efficiency, improve air quality, and prolong the lifespan of the air conditioning system.
Is It Possible to Install an AC Unit on My Own?
Mounting an air conditioner on your own is possible for those with adequate skills and knowledge. However, it typically necessitates careful evaluation of local building codes, the right tools, and knowledge of both electrical components and refrigerant systems to ensure safety and efficiency.
How Long Does an Air Conditioning System Typically Last?
The standard lifespan of an air conditioning system typically ranges from 15 to 20 years. Elements that impact lifespan encompass maintenance habits, frequency of use, and the standard of the original installation, influencing the system's overall performance and energy efficiency.
